Commonly Seen Sewer Line Issues

Broken: split, offset or collapsed pipe: Pipes have actually been harmed due to shifting soil, frozen ground, settling, etc.
Blockage: Grease buildup or a foreign object is limiting or restricting proper circulation and/or cleaning of the line.
Corrosion: The pipe has actually deteriorated and/or broken, causing collapses in the line and restricting circulation.
Bellied pipe: A section of the pipe has actually sunk due to ground or soil conditions, creating a valley that gathers paper and waste.
Leaking joints: The seals between pipelines have broken, permitting water to escape into the area surrounding the pipe.
Root in sewer line: Tree or shrub roots have attacked the drain line and/or have damaged the line, avoiding regular cleaning.
Off-grade pipe: Existing pipes are constructed of low quality product that may have weakened or corroded.

Traditional Sewage Line Repair Method

Sewer line repair work is typically carried out utilizing the "open cut" or "trench" technique to get to the location surrounding the harmed portion of the pipe. A backhoe may be utilized to open and fill up the workspace.

Pipe Bursting

We make little gain access to holes where the harmed pipeline starts and ends. Utilizing your damaged sewer line as a guide, our hydraulic machine pulls full-sized replacement pipeline through the old path and separate the harmed pipeline at the same time. The new pipeline is extremely resistant to leaks and root invasion, with a long life span.

Pipe Relining Process


Relining is the procedure of repairing damaged sewage system pipes by creating a "pipeline within a pipeline" to bring back function and flow. Epoxy relining products mold to the inside of the existing pipe to develop a smooth brand-new inner wall, much like the lining discovered in food cans.

Lot of times, pipeline relining can be carried out through a building's clean-out gain access to and frequently requires little digging. Pipe relining might be utilized to fix root-damaged pipelines; seal fractures and holes; and fill in missing out on pipeline and seal joint connections underground, in roof drain pipelines, in storm lines and under concrete. The relined pipeline is smooth and durable, and all products used in the relining procedure are non-hazardous.
